What is the average salary in Wisconsin Dells, WI?

The average salary in Wisconsin Dells, WI is $54,679 per year.

Job seekers in Wisconsin Dells, WI, can expect a range of salary opportunities. The average yearly salary stands at $54,679. This figure reflects the diverse job market in the area. Salaries vary based on the type of job and the level of experience.


The salary distribution shows a range from $23,815 to $155,000. Most jobs fall within the middle of this range, with a significant portion earning between $35,741 and $83,445. This spread offers many options for professionals at different stages in their careers. The data highlights the potential for growth and advancement in various industries.

What are the best paying jobs in Wisconsin Dells, WI?

Job seekers in Wisconsin Dells can find well-paying opportunities in various fields. Registered Nurses lead the way with an average salary of $89,604. This role requires a strong commitment to patient care and a nursing degree. Staff Nurses and Licensed Practical Nurses also offer competitive salaries, with averages of $87,401 and $73,131, respectively. Other high-paying jobs include Delivery Drivers, with an average salary of $39,678, and Maintenance Technicians, earning around $38,939. These positions demand specific skills and often offer benefits. Housekeeping and Front Desk Associates, while lower in pay, still provide a stable income with salaries around $32,500 and $31,000. These jobs offer good starting points for those entering the workforce.

What are the best paying jobs in Wisconsin Dells, WI without a degree?

Job seekers in Wisconsin Dells can find good-paying jobs without needing a degree. Line cooks earn an average of $33,583, while groundskeepers make around $33,146. Housekeeping staff can expect to earn $32,528, and servers make about $32,479. These roles offer competitive pay and are accessible to those without a college degree. Additionally, baristas earn around $31,333, server assistants make $29,926, and dishwashers earn $28,844. These positions provide opportunities for steady income and career growth in a welcoming community.

Which companies offer the top salaries in Wisconsin Dells, WI?

Job seekers in Wisconsin Dells, WI, have several options for high-paying companies. Kalahari Resorts & Conventions leads with an average salary of $47,341. This makes it a top choice for those seeking competitive pay. Other notable employers include Bluegreen Vacations, with an average salary of $43,383, and MasterCorp, offering $36,805 on average. These companies provide attractive compensation packages, making them appealing to professionals in the area. CHULA VISTA RESORT, Kwik Trip, and Wilderness Hotel and Resort Inc also offer competitive salaries. McDonald's, while lower on the list, still provides a respectable average salary of $32,914. These figures highlight the range of opportunities available for job seekers in Wisconsin Dells.
